Disco .22 with a stock spring with 3 full coils cut off.
I have tried two different spring guides (see pics below, sorry no side-by-side). One of them is a rivet that sits perfectly into the recess of the end cap. The other has a lip that is too wide to fit into the recess, so it has much more preload even without screwing it in. The rivet is slightly (1/8") longer than the other piece.
I am able to crank the power adjuster in with both of them until I cannot cock the gun. I then back it out until it finally cocks. At that "full power" setting the rivet gets a max power of 708 fps, but the other gets a max of 814 fps.
Now that would make sense to me thinking, "the longer spring guide (rivet) is "bottoming out" on the hammer causing it to not cock, rather than it actually being "coil bind" as the stopping point." The only problem is, it is the SHORTER spring guide that is getting the higher fps.
Anyone have any clue what is going on?
Some thoughts:
-Hammer travel distance is longer with the shorter guide, so more momentum.
-Rivet is narrower so it is causing some problem with the spring as it compresses by being off center

The hammer travel distance is set by the distance between the trigger sear and the valve stem, so that is a constant.... My guess is that the larger OD guide, when screwed forward, hits the back of the hammer, I'm pretty sure the hole is the same size as the hole in the rear cap.... Therefore, you are not getting "coil bind" with the larger OD guide, but rather "hammer bind".... With the smaller OD guide, which fits inside the hole in the hammer, you can increase the preload more than with the larger guide until you really do experience "coil bind"....
